Berry Crumble Cake
Ingredients –
For the Cake:
Fresh or frozen mixed berries β 250g (1Β½ cups)
Eggs β 3
Sugar β 175g (ΒΎ cup + 2 tablespoons)
Salt β ΒΌ teaspoon
Plain yogurt β 150g (β
cup)
Oil β 100ml (β
cup + 1 tablespoon)
Plain flour β 200g (1β
cups)
Baking powder β 1Β½ teaspoons
Vanilla extract β 1 teaspoon
For the Crumble Topping:
Butter β 55g (ΒΌ cup), melted
Plain flour β 50g (β
cup)
Sugar β 75g (ΒΌ cup + 2 tablespoons)
Equipment:
Measuring cup size: 240ml
Baking dish: 28 Γ 18 cm (11 Γ 7 inches)
Bake in a preheated oven at 180Β°C (350Β°F) for 45β50 minutes.
Method –
Prepare the Cake:
In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the eggs, sugar, vanilla extract and salt for about 4 minutes, or until the mixture is pale, light and fluffy.
Add the plain yogurt and whisk for 1 minute until smooth.
Pour in the oil and whisk for another 1 minute until fully incorporated.
Sift the plain flour and baking powder directly into the bowl.
Gently fold the dry ingredients into the batter until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
Pour the batter into a lined baking dish and spread it evenly.
Scatter the fresh or frozen berries evenly over the top of the batter.
Prepare the Crumble Topping:
In a small bowl, combine the melted butter, plain flour and sugar.
Mix together until the mixture becomes crumbly.
Sprinkle the crumble topping evenly over the berries.
Bake:
Bake in a preheated oven at 180Β°C (350Β°F) for 45β50 minutes, or until the crumble is golden brown and a skewer inserted into the centre of the cake comes out clean.
Allow the cake to cool slightly before serving.
Serve
Enjoy warm with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a dollop of whipped cream, or allow it to cool completely and enjoy with a cup of tea or coffee.
